Remove TARGET_SETUP_INCOMING_VARARG_BOUNDS
TARGET_SETUP_INCOMING_VARARG_BOUNDS seems to be an unused vestige of the MPX support. 2019-08-15 Richard Sandiford <richard.sandiford@arm.com> gcc/ * target.def (setup_incoming_vararg_bounds): Remove. * doc/tm.texi.in (TARGET_SETUP_INCOMING_VARARG_BOUNDS): Remove. * doc/tm.texi: Regenerate. * targhooks.c (default_setup_incoming_vararg_bounds): Delete. * targhooks.h (default_setup_incoming_vararg_bounds): Likewise. * config/i386/i386.c (ix86_setup_incoming_vararg_bounds): Likewise. (TARGET_SETUP_INCOMING_VARARG_BOUNDS): Likewise. From-SVN: r274539
